Ekstensi Safari 10 baru untuk iOS 10 dan macOS Sierra

Ekstensi Safari 10

Sejak tahun lalu bekerja dengan pemblokir konten web, kami telah mempelajari bahwa Apple Safari 10 yang baru akan memungkinkan banyak hal berbagai ekstensi kode asli yang dapat diperoleh dan diperbarui oleh pengguna secara otomatis melalui Mac App Store, yang akan meningkatkan kinerja, keamanan, dan keandalan mesin pencari.

Pada tahun 2010 Apple memperkenalkan galeri ekstensi untuk Safari 5, memungkinkan pengembang untuk menyiapkan plugin dari standar seperti CCS dan JavaScript. Ini memungkinkan penambahan tombol, mengubah bilah menu dan tindakan lain yang difokuskan pada pengembangan dan pemeliharaan aplikasi.

Kembali pada tahun 2014, Apple mempresentasikan Ekstensi Aplikasi, arsitektur baru untuk mengembangkan komponen aplikasi di iOS dan macOS seperti opsi untuk berbagi konten di jejaring sosial, mendukung widget dan keyboard untuk iOS. Pada 2015, Cupertino memperkenalkan pemblokir konten bahwa mereka memiliki kemampuan untuk melakukannya hindari unduhan yang tidak diinginkan, popup dan elemen navigasi lainnya.

Ekstensi asli di Safari 10

Apple telah mengumumkan bahwa browser baru akan mendukung ekstensi aplikasi yang dikembangkan dari kombinasi JavaScript, CSS, dan kode asli di Objective-C atau Swift dan ini akan memungkinkan pihak ketiga untuk menambahkan fungsi baru seperti membaca dan mengedit konten serta mengintegrasikan dan memperoleh data melalui aplikasi di web.

Ekstensi Arsitektur Aplikasi untuk Safari 10

Pengembang bisa memperluas antarmuka pengguna menambahkan tombol dan alat atau menyisipkan kode JavaScript yang akan mengubah perilaku halaman dan memungkinkannya untuk berkomunikasi dengan aplikasi.

Yang membedakan ekstensi Safari 10 dari yang lama adalah yang baru dapat berkomunikasi secara aman dengan aplikasi melalui sumber daya bersama. Di sisi lain, arsitektur baru yang memungkinkan pengembang mendistribusikan ekstensi Anda sebagai bagian dari aplikasi melalui App Store dan bukan sebagai plugin terpisah.

Untuk pengembang, pindahkan ekstensi Anda sudah dibuat ke aplikasi asli Ekstensi Aplikasi akan sangat sederhana melalui Xcode. Perubahan ini akan mengizinkan pengguna Ekstensi Aplikasi perbarui sejajar dengan ekstensi, yang akan menghindari masalah kompatibilitas.

Kemampuan untuk mengembangkan aplikasi dalam kode asli akan memungkinkan aplikasi Ekstensi Aplikasi untuk bekerja lebih cepat dan lebih efektif, mengurangi konsumsi sumber daya.

Apple Pay di Safari 10 dan ekstensi

Safari 10 juga akan memiliki dukungan untuk Operasi Apple Pay, tampilan terpisah di iPad, video HTML 5 yang disematkan di Mac, dan penggunaan otomatis Video HTML5 di situs yang memerlukan penggunaan Adobe Flash atau Microsoft Silverlight.

Dengan arsitektur baru ini, pengembang akan dapat memperluas kemungkinan aplikasi dan aplikasi mereka sendiri sistem operasi, iOS dan macOS Sierra. Berbagai macam ekstensi pihak ketiga dapat disesuaikan dengan aplikasi seperti Peta, notifikasi, direktori panggilan dan Siri. 


Beli domain
Anda tertarik dengan:
Rahasia meluncurkan situs web Anda dengan sukses

tinggalkan Komentar Anda

Alamat email Anda tidak akan dipublikasikan. Bidang yang harus diisi ditandai dengan *

*

*

  1. Penanggung jawab data: Miguel Ángel Gatón
  2. Tujuan data: Mengontrol SPAM, manajemen komentar.
  3. Legitimasi: Persetujuan Anda
  4. Komunikasi data: Data tidak akan dikomunikasikan kepada pihak ketiga kecuali dengan kewajiban hukum.
  5. Penyimpanan data: Basis data dihosting oleh Occentus Networks (UE)
  6. Hak: Anda dapat membatasi, memulihkan, dan menghapus informasi Anda kapan saja.